Shipra will seek justice till her last drop of blood: RAB

Shipra DebnathFacebook

Till her very last drop of blood, she will seek justice for the wrong that was carried out against her, Shipra Debnath told the Rapid Action Battalion (RAB) during interrogations.

At a press conference held on Monday at the RAB headquarters, the elite forces’ legal and media wing director Ashik Billah told the media about Shipra’s contention.

Shipra was released on bail on Sunday, after facing charges under the narcotics control act at the Ramu police station in Cox’s Bazar.

Quoting Shipra, the RAB spokesman said, “She said she would seek justice till her last drop of blood. Till the last day of her life, she would seek justice for the wrong that was done against her.”

The spokesperson said RAB will speak to Shahedul Islam alias Sifat. RAB will provide all protection to Shipra and Sifat.

The RAB investigating team feels that it is important to speak in detail with the eye witness of the incident Sifat as well as Shipra before they interrogate the former police officer-in-charge (OC) Pradeep Kumar Das, inspector Liaqat Ali and Nandadulal Rakkhit.

He said, the three accused were supposed to be taken on remand and interrogated today but that is not happening.

Ashik Billah said, RAB will also investigate the two cases at the Teknaf police station and three at the Ramu police station filed by the police after the Sinha killing. They have sought the police’s permission in this regard.

He said that RAB would be able to take on 10 day remand the accused in the case filed by Shahria Sharmin, sister of the retired major Sinha Md Rashed Khan who was shot dead by police in Teknaf.

The court that said that the remand could be extended in the interests of the investigations.
